How to deal with the situation where 500 cubic meters of Sudan oil cannot be drained?

First, it is necessary to determine the reason why it cannot be unloaded. 1. If it has hardened, consider what methods and heat sources can be used to raise the temperature. The original poster said there’s no boiler, so the only option is to use another external heat source: lol. 2. If the problem isn’t due to freezing, then it’s necessary to determine whether it’s a device-related issue – the pump, valves, pipelines, and other accessories; go through them one by one! :L

There are heating coils in which heat transfer oil can be circulated to achieve melting. Two issues need to be taken into account: if the coils are not clean, the heat transfer oil will become contaminated; if the coils in a floating roof tank are located at the bottom, the expansion that occurs due to the heating of the crude oil must be considered. For specific procedures, refer to Huang Chunfang’s book published by Sinopec Press, as detailed answers to this issue can be found there.
